AS many as 200 people have disappeared on cruise ships since the year 2000 sparking fears that a killer could be targeting liners. In addition to those who went overboard an estimated 49 people have also gone missing on cruise ships since 2000. Often the missing person is not reported until after luggage goes unclaimed making the chances of finding them dismal at best.
